Three Rivers Scenes
Four paintings were done for the 2008 Three Rivers Art Studio Tour, and they have been reproduced as quality cards, blank on the inside, 4 1/4 x 5 1/2 inches, with matching white envelopes. The cards are offered as a set of four at a price of $10, postage included. This painting depicts the Pumpkin Hollow Bridge, built 1922.

This painting (which has been sold) depicts the old Kaweah Post Office, the smallest operating post office in the United States, which is a designated historical site.

This painting (also sold) was done from a photo I took on North Fork Drive in Three Rivers when both the poppies and lupine were blooming.

The final painting depicts Alta Peak which, in winter, wears a coat of snow that is plainly an elephant. Locals can tell a great deal about the snow cover, how fast the melt is happening and the Spring rafting season by the amount of the elephant still covered in snow.
